Miami Bouncers Arrested After Patrons Brutalized


MIAMI (CelebrityAccess MediaWire) — 8 bounces at Club Mansion, a popular Miami nightclub have been arrested after allegedly issuing a savage beat-down to a trio of spring-breakers over a disagreement about a $700 bar tab.

According to the Sun-Sentinel, the three men, Trevor F. Costello, Sean R. Sweeney and John Merryman, had been partying at the club and when their hefty bar tab arrived, the trio disputed it. Bouncers escorted the men to a back office where the disagreement escalated until one bouncer punched Costello in the face.

"This ignited a full-scale brawl in which the victims were punched and kicked repeatedly by all of the defendants," a police officer wrote in the report. "[The victims] were beaten and stomped while on the ground."

Another bouncer flagged down police who found the patrons suffering from a variety of cuts and bruises. Paramedics treated the men at the scene. The eight bouncers were arrested and charged with battery or aggravated battery. A number of additional employees at the club, run by the Opium Group may face charges and the men have already filed a 10 count lawsuit against Opium's parent company, Star Island Entertainment, alleging false imprisonment and negligence. – CelebrityAccess Staff Writers
